The Journal of Engineering Student Design Projects is a peer-reviewed, open-access journal devoted to archival papers in all fields engineering student design projects. The mission of the Journal of Engineering Student Design Projects is to be a scholarly forum that archives, studies, and improves the design activity of students pursuing degrees in engineering and related disciplines.
The journal includes all activities related to engineering student design projects including case studies of the design project, case studies of teaching or advising a project, study of the design teams, and any activity related to engineering student design projects. The journal includes activity in all engineering sub-disciplines and closely related disciplines. There are no restrictions on authorship: any combination of undergraduate students, graduate students, faculty and others may form an authorship team.
